Chiesa dei SS Jacopo e Filippo in Orticaia - Pisa in Tuscany
The name “Orticaia" (nettle-bed) probably derives from the territory invaded by nettles or a place rich in vegetable gardens (in Latin Horticarium). The Romanesque-style church (12th century) was modified several times, while the low bell tower was built in the 17th century directly on the wall of the apse.
The façade, made up of stone in the lower part and of bricks in the upper one, seems to be asymmetric due to the presence of a square window on the left of the door. The interior has a single nave with Baroque frescoes attributed to the Melani brothers, among which stands out the “Conversion of St. Ranieri” (which probably took place just in this church).
